This year’s theme, being the 10th year of
Bourne Free, will be ‘Decades’. This theme
can be interpreted in as many ideas as you
can think of for theming your costume or
float for the parade.
The dates for Bourne Free 2014 are confirmed as Friday
11th July to Sunday 13th July, with the parade on Saturday 12th July from
noon starting on top of the East Cliff (by the East Cliff lift), making its way through the
town and arriving at The Triangle at 12 noon.
